Output ddbd43852ac271443086bb3b56b1f92a843552bc8e1c5c385a48ada394ab7abb:1

value
8386279
script pubkey
OP_0 OP_PUSHBYTES_20 03ef7fb13bbc9908f9b3495701def01ae99bbfeb
address
bc1qq0hhlvfmhjvs37dnf9tsrhhsrt5eh0ltl3mult
transaction
ddbd43852ac271443086bb3b56b1f92a843552bc8e1c5c385a48ada394ab7abb
confirmations
314923
spent
true